AlibabaCloudの導入プロジェクトの手順

AlibabaCloudの導入プロジェクトの手順

1.rpmダウンロードアドレスhttp://www.oracle.com/technetwork/java/javase/downloads/index.html

2.openjdkがインストールされている場合はアンインストールします

[root @ kuangshen〜] #java -version
java version“ 1.8.0_121”
Java™SEランタイム環境(ビルド1.8.0_121-b13)JavaHotSpot
™64ビットサーバーVM(ビルド25.121-b13、混合モード)

試験

[root @ kuangshen〜] #rpm -qa | grep jdk
jdk1.8.0_121-1.8.0_121-fcs.x86_64

アンインストール-e--nodeps強制削除

[root @ kuangshen〜] #rpm -e --nodeps jdk1.8.0_121-1.8.0_121-fcs.x86_64
[root @ kuangshen〜]
#java -version -bash:/ usr / bin / java:そのようなファイルまたはディレクトリはありません#OK
3、安装JDK

Javarpmをインストールします

[root @ kuangshen kuangshen] #rpm -ivh jdk-8u221-linux-x64.rpm

インストールが完了したら、環境変数ファイルを構成します:/ etc / profile

JAVA_HOME = / usr / java / jdk1.8.0_221-amd64
CLASSPATH =%JAVA_HOME%/ lib:%JAVA_HOME%/ jre / lib
PATH = PATH:PATH:P A T H JAVA_HOME / bin:$ JAVA_HOME / jre / bin
export PATH CLASSPATH JAVA_HOME

保存して終了

新しい環境変数を有効にしましょう!

ソース/ etc / profile

javaバージョンをテストする

[root @ kuangshen java] #java -version
java version“ 1.8.0_221”
Java™SEランタイム環境(ビルド1.8.0_221-b11)JavaHotSpot
™64ビットサーバーVM(ビルド25.221-b11、混合モード)

Tomcatのインストール(解凍インストール)

1. Java環境をインストールした後、Tomcatをテストできます。Tomcatインストールパッケージを準備してください!

2.ファイルを/ usr / tomcat /に移動し、解凍します。

[root @ kuangshen kuangshen] #mv apache-tomcat-9.0.22.tar.gz / usr
[root @ kuangshen kuangshen] #cd / usr
[root @ kuangshen usr] #ls
apache-tomcat-9.0.22.tar.gz
[root @ kuangshen usr] #tar -zxvf apache-tomcat-9.0.22.tar.gz#解凍
3. Tomcatを実行し、binディレクトリに入ります。これはWindowsで表示されていたものと同じです。

実行:startup.sh-> start tomcat

実行:shutdown.sh-> Tomcatをシャットダウンします

./startup.sh
./shutdown.sh
4、Linuxファイアウォールポートが開いていることを確認します。クラウドAli、Aliクラウドの場合は、セキュリティグループポリシーが開いていることを確認する必要があります。

ファイアウォールサービスのステータスを表示する

systemctl status Firewalld

開く、再起動する、閉じる、firewalld.serviceサービス

オンにする

サービスfirewalldstart

リブート

サービスfirewalld再起動

シャットダウン

サービスfirewalldstop

ファイアウォールルールを表示する

Firewall-cmd --list-all#すべての情報を表示
firewall-cmd --list-ports#ポート情報のみを表示

ポートを開く

ポートを開くコマンド:firewall-cmd --zone = public --add-port = 80 / tcp --permanent
ファイアウォールを再起動します:systemctl restartファイアウォールd.service

コマンドの意味:
–zone #scope
–add-port = 80 / tcp ポートを追加します。形式は次のとおりです。ポート/通信プロトコル
–permanent #permanent効果、このパラメーターなしで再起動すると無効になります

Dockerをインストールします(yumインストール)

CentOS 7
公式Webサイトインストールリファレンスマニュアルに基づくインストール:https://docs.docker.com/install/linux/docker-ce/centos/

CentOS7以上であることを確認してください

[root @ 192 Desktop]
#cat / etc / redhat-release CentOS Linuxリリース7.2.1511(コア)
gcc関連をインストールするためのyum(仮想マシンがインターネットにアクセスできることを確認する必要があります)

yum -y install gcc
yum -y install gcc-c ++
古いバージョンをアンインストールします

yum -y remove docker docker-common docker-selinux docker-engine

公式サイト版

yum remove docker
docker-client
docker-client-latest
docker-common
docker-latest
docker-latest-logrotate
docker-logrotatedocker
-engine
安装需要的软件包

yum install -y yum-utils device-mapper-persistent-data lvm2set
安定したミラーウェアハウス

エラー

yum-config-manager --add-repo https://download.docker.com/linux/centos/docker-ce.repo

エラーを報告する

[Errno 14] curl#35-ピアによってTCP接続がリセットされました
[Errno 12] curl#35-タイムアウト

国内での使用を正しくお勧めします

yum-config-manager --add-repo http://mirrors.aliyun.com/docker-ce/linux/centos/docker-ce.repo
update yum package index

yummakecache高速
インストールDockerCE

yum -y install docker-ce docker-ce-clicontainerd.io
启πdocker

systemctl start docker
test

Dockerバージョン

docker runhello-world

Docker画像

おすすめ

転載: blog.csdn.net/weixin_43941676/article/details/113863432